The Chemistry Behind Copper's Symbol: Cu

Copper, a reddish-brown metal known for its excellent conductivity, holds a significant/vital/crucial role in our modern world. Its chemical symbol, Cu, is derived from the Latin/ancient Roman/European word "cuprum," referring to the island of Cyprus, where copper was first mined/has historical significance/played a key part in antiquity. This symbol, universally recognized by scientists and engineers alike, represents/denotes/indicates this essential element on the periodic table.

Cu's atomic number, 29, corresponds to/reflects/indicates the number of protons found within its nucleus.
